Showbiz reporter Richard Arnold laughed his way through a hilarious blunder on Good Morning Britain - which left him so embarassed he said we would 'leave' the show.

As his segment began on Wednesday 5 June, Richard chatted about the trailer for Bridgerton season three part two - which teases the continuing love story between Colin Bridgerton and Penelope Featherington.

As the clip came to an end, Richard continued to say, “and just to wet your Ladydown Whistle'' - rather than Penelope’s real pen name, Lady Whistledown.

As Richard corrected himself, Susanna Reid couldn’t help but laugh hysterically. Richard added: “Well that’s out there forever!” before joking, “I’ll leave now.” Meanwhile co-presenters Susanna and Martin Lewis continued to giggle off-screen.
